Andrew Clark 1811–1893 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 10 Oct 1811

Birth Location: Catawissa, Columbia County, Pennsylvania, USA

Death Date: 24 Nov 1893

Death Location: Catawissa, Columbia County, Pennsylvania, USA

Father: William Clark

Mother: Florence Watson

Spouse(s): Anna Boone

Children(s): Alice Clark, Mary Clark

The story of Andrew Clark began in 1811 in Catawissa, Columbia County, Pennsylvania, USA. In 1850, Andrew Clark resided in Montour, Columbia, Pennsylvania, USA. In 1860, Andrew Clark resided in Montour, Rupert, Columbia, Pennsylvania, USA. Andrew Clark married Anna Boone, and had children including Alice Martha Clark, Mary Boone Clark. Andrew Clark passed away in 1893 in Catawissa, Columbia County, Pennsylvania, USA.
